摘要:
Evidence from observational studies and clinical trials has reported that gut microbiota (GM) was associated with chronic lung diseases (CLDs). However, the causal relationships between GM and CLDs have yet to be fully ascertained. The Mendelian randomization (MR) based causal analysis was performed using the genome-wide association study (GWAS) summary statistics from the MiBioGen and FinnGen consortium. GM served as exposure, and CLDs were taken for outcomes. Inverse variance weighted, MR-Egger, and weighted median methods were utilized to examine the causal association between GM and CLDs. ...
